Itinerary Details

The tour begins at the vibrant Hoi An Market, where visitors can enjoy the sights, colors, and local experiences.

Visitors can enjoy the sights, colors, and local experiences of the vibrant Hoi An Market.

Next, they’ll visit the Phuc Kien Chinese Assembly Hall, admiring its luxurious gates and dragon statues.

They’ll then explore either the Phung Hung or Tan Ky Ancient House, well-preserved for 200 years.

The tour continues at the Hoi An Folk Culture Museum, housed in a 150-year-old Chinese merchant house.

Finally, they’ll view the Japanese Bridge, built over 400 years ago with significant carvings, and have the option to visit handicraft shops and art galleries in the picturesque streets.

Hoi An Ancient Houses

Hoi An’s ancient houses captivate visitors with their well-preserved architecture and fascinating history.

Tourists can explore either Phung Hung or Tan Ky, two of the most famous ancient houses, which date back over 200 years.

These grand structures showcase the harmonious blend of Vietnamese, Chinese, and Japanese influences through ornate carvings, mosaic-tiled roofs, and intricate wooden beams.

Wandering through the rooms and courtyards offers a glimpse into the lives of prosperous merchant families who once resided here.

These historic homes are true gems, preserving Hoi An’s cultural heritage and providing a window into the past.

Hoi An Folk Culture Museum

The Hoi An Folk Culture Museum offers visitors a captivating glimpse into the region’s traditional way of life. Housed in a 150-year-old Chinese merchant house, the museum showcases authentic artifacts, handicrafts, and cultural performances.

Visitors can explore the well-preserved interiors and learn about the daily lives, customs, and rituals of the local people. The museum’s collection includes traditional costumes, household items, and agricultural tools, providing a deeper understanding of Hoi An’s rich heritage.

With its immersive experiences, the Hoi An Folk Culture Museum offers a fascinating window into the past, allowing visitors to connect with the area’s vibrant cultural traditions.
